Output 31bd56e595c572161a0277e96f55fbb48cd693eda60920b037dec6023d4da7ab:39

value
20203
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a67b257a183b3a0ead18f91011cf783537f5e8cd OP_EQUAL
address
3GsHckQACDPNmB8maRmk9kYtLbo1NsGpzt
transaction
31bd56e595c572161a0277e96f55fbb48cd693eda60920b037dec6023d4da7ab
confirmations
254563
spent
true